ENGINE AND ENGINE COOLING:ENGINE; ENGINE AND ENGINE COOLING:EXHAUST SYSTEM:MANIFOLD/HEADER/MUFFLER/TAIL PIPE

Oct 26, 2015
1,003,556 units potentially affected
The defect: General Motors LLC (GM) is recalling certain model year 1998-1999 Chevrolet Lumina and Oldsmobile Intrigue, 1997-2004 Buick Regal and Pontiac Grand Prix, 2000-2004 Chevrolet Impala, and 1998-2004 Chevrolet Monte Carlo vehicles. The affected vehicles were previously repaired under recalls 08V-118, 09V-116, and 15V-201 to address the possibility that engine oil may drip onto the hot exhaust manifold.
The risk: Engine oil that drips onto the hot surface of the exhaust manifold may result in a fire.
The remedy: The remedy applied under recalls 08V-118, 09V-116, and 15V-201 did not adequately remove the safety risk. Under the improved remedy, dealers will replace the engine’s front valve cover and gasket. Vehicles that are covered by recalls 08V-118, 09V-116, or 15V-201 that have not yet received the original remedy will instead receive the improved remedy under the original recall number. The recall began on February 19, 2016. Owners may contact Chevrolet customer service at 1-800-222-1020, Buick customer service at 1-800-521-7300, Oldsmobile customer service at 1-800-442-6537 and Pontiac customer service at 1-800-458-8006. GM's number for this recall is 15757. Note: Until the improved remedy has been applied, owners are advised to park their vehicle outside since the fire risk exists even when the vehicle is unattended.

ENGINE AND ENGINE COOLING

Apr 8, 2009
1,497,516 units potentially affected
The defect: GENERAL MOTORS IS RECALLING 1,497,516 MY 1997-2003 BUICK REGAL, MY 1998-2003 CHEVROLET LUMINA, MONTE CARLO AND IMPALA, MY 1998-1999 OLDSMOBILE INTRIGUE, MY 1997-2003 PONTIAC GRAND PRIX VEHICLES EQUIPPED WITH A 3.8L V6 NATURALLY ASPIRATED ENGINE. SOME OF THESE VEHICLES HAVE A CONDITION IN WHICH DROPS OF ENGINE OIL MAY BE DEPOSITED ON THE EXHAUST MANIFOLD THROUGH HARD BRAKING.
The risk: IF THE MANIFOLD IS HOT ENOUGH AND THE OIL RUNS BELOW THE HEAT SHIELD, IT MAY IGNITE INTO A SMALL FLAME AND MAY SPREAD TO THE PLASTIC SPARK PLUG WIRE CHANNEL AND BEYOND INCREASING THE RISK OF AN ENGINE COMPARTMENT FIRE.
The remedy: DEALERS WILL REPLACE THE ENGINE’S FRONT VALVE COVER AND FRONT-VALVE-COVER GASKET WITH NEW PARTS OF AN IMPROVED DESIGN AND REMOVE THE ENGINE’S PLASTIC COVER AND PLASTIC OIL-FILL-TUBE EXTENSION, FREE OF CHARGE. THE RECALL IS EXPECTED TO BEGIN DURING MAY 2016. STEERING

Feb 17, 2009
979 units potentially affected
The defect: DORMAN IS RECALLING 979 STEERING KNUCKLES, DORMAN P/NOS. 697-902 AND 697-903, SOLD UNDER DORMAN'S "OE SOLUTIONS<SUP>TM</SUP>" BRAND NAME, AND NAPA P/NOS. 7-8502 AND 7-8503 WHICH WERE SOLD FOR REPLACEMENT USE ON THE VARIOUS VEHICLES LISTED ABOVE. A POTENTIAL MATERIAL OR DESIGN DEFECT COULD RESULT IN THE STEERING KNUCKLE BREAKING IN THE HUB AREA.
The risk: A BROKEN STEERING KNUCKLE COULD RESULT IN LOSS OF STEERING CONTROL AND A POSSIBLE CRASH WITHOUT WARNING.
The remedy: DORMAN WILL NOTIFY OWNERS AND REPLACE THE DEFECTIVE STEERING KNUCKLES FREE OF CHARGE AND REIMBURSE THE REPAIR FACILITY OR OWNER FOR LABOR. THE RECALL BEGAN ON FEBRUARY 23, 2009. OWNERS MAY CONTACT DORMAN'S TOLL-FREE HOTLINE AT 1-800-523-2492 AND PRESS 5.

EA03019ClosedEngineering Analysis

POWER RACK AND PINION STEERING FAILURE

Opened Sep 15, 2003
Closed Dec 18, 2003

GM'S LETTER TO NHTSA DATED DECEMBER 11, 2003, EXPANDS ITS ORIGINAL RECALL (NHTSA 02V286) TO INCLUDE CERTAIN W-BODY VEHICLES: 96-97 OLDS CUTLASS SUPREME; 98 OLDS INTRIGUE; 97-98 OLDS CUTLASS; 97-98 CHEVY LUMINA, MONTE CARLO AND MALIBU; 96 PONTIAC GRAND PRIX; AND 96-98 BUICK REGAL.THE NUMBER OF VEHICLES RECALLED IS 750,283.GM DETERMINED THAT FAILURE OF THE RACK AND PINION IS RELATED TO DAMAGE OF THE LOWER PINION BEARING AND THE LEVEL OF THE PINION BEARING PRE-LOAD SPRING FORCE.GM STATES, HIGHER RACK PRE-LOAD SPRING FORCE (133 LB.) IS THE DESIGN CHARACTERISTIC MOST CLOSELY ASSOCIATED WITH HIGHER BEARING DAMAGE RATES IN MOST OF THE VEHICLE APPLICATIONS THAT USED THE GENERAL BEARING COMPANY (GBC) BEARING.ALL OF THE VEHICLES COVERED IN THE EXPANDED RECALL HAVE THE 133 LB SPRING FORCE.THE 96 LUMINA/MONTE CARLO AND 97-98 CENTURY W-BODY VEHICLES INCLUDED IN THIS INVESTIGATION UTILIZE A LOWER SPRING FORCE AND ARE NOT INCLUDED IN THE RECALL.

RQ03001ClosedRecall Query

POWER RACK AND PINION STEERING FAILURE

Opened Jan 2, 2003
Closed Sep 15, 2003

GM CONDUCTED A SAFETY RECALL (NHTSA # 02V286) TO ADDRESS A STEERING DEFECT PERTAINING TO A LOWER PINION BEARING (LPB) WITHIN THE RACK AND PINION STEERING GEAR (R&P). THE RECALL COVERED 1,159,156 MODEL YEAR 1997-1998 PONTIAC GRAND PRIX VEHICLES BUILT BETWEEN MARCH 1, 1996 AND OCTOBER 31, 1997, 1996-1998 PONTIAC TRANS SPORT, CHEVROLET LUMINA APV, CHEVROLET VENTURE, OLDSMOBILE SILHOUETTE MINIVANS, AND CHEVROLET CAVALIER AND PONTIAC SUNFIRE SEDANS BUILT BETWEEN JANUARY 1, 1996 AND OCTOBER 31, 1997.ODI OPENED THIS RQ AFTER RECEIVING REPORTS THAT OTHER VEHICLES WERE EXHIBITING THE SAME SYMPTOMS AS THE RECALLED VEHICLES.BASED ON ODI'S REVIEW OF TECHNICAL AND COMPLAINT DATA COLLECTED DURING THE RQ, THE W-CARS ARE ASSOCIATED WITH EITHER A HIGHER STEERING COMPLAINT RATE OR A HIGHER LPB FAILURE RATE THAN THE OTHER VEHICLES INVESTIGATED UNDER THE RQ AND ARE ABOVE OR NEAR THE RATES FOR THE RECALLED VEHICLES.THUS, ODI WILL FURTHER EXAMINE THE W-CARS (1996-1997 OLDSMOBILE CUTLASS SUPREME, 1996-1998 BUICK REGAL, CHEVROLET LUMINA, CHEVROLET MONTE CARLO, 1997-1998 BUICK CENTURY, AND 1998 OLDSMOBILE INTRIGUE) UNDER A NEW INVESTIGATION, ENGINEERING ANALYSIS (EA)03-019.

EA02030ClosedEngineering Analysis

ENGINE COMPARTMENT FIRES

Opened Oct 22, 2002
Closed Mar 9, 2004

EA02-030 IS CLOSED WITH GMEA02-030 IS CLOSED WITH GM?S ACTIONS IN 03V-473 AND 04V-090 RECALLING APPROXIMATELY 529,000 MY 1998-99 C- AND H-BODY VEHICLES EQUIPPED WITH DEFECTIVE FUEL PRESSURE REGULATORS.THESE VEHICLES WERE EQUIPPED WITH PLASTIC INTAKE MANIFOLDS THAT ARE UNABLE TO CONTAIN PRESSURES THAT OCCUR IN SOME BACKFIRE EVENTS AND DEFECTIVE FUEL PRESSURE REGULATORS WITH LEAKING DIAPHRAGMS THAT CAN PROVIDE A SOURCE OF FUEL TO PRODUCE A COMBUSTIBLE AIR-FUEL MIXTURE IN THE MANIFOLD.THE CLOSING OF THIS INVESTIGATION DOES NOT CONSTITUTE A FINDING BY ODI THAT NO SAFETY DEFECT EXISTS IN THE VEHICLES THAT ARE NOT INCLUDED IN GM?S RECALLS.ODI WILL CONTINUE TO MONITOR THE INCIDENCE OF MANIFOLD RUPTURES AND RELATED FIRES IN OTHER MY 1995-2002 GM PASSENGER CARS EQUIPPED WITH THE SUBJECT INTAKE MANIFOLD.FOR ADDITIONAL INFORMATION, SEE THE ATTACHED CLOSING REPORT.
